About James A. Cromlish

James A. Cromlish is a scholar working on Cell Biology, Endocrine and Autonomic Systems and Cellular and Molecular Neuroscience, having authored 27 papers that have together received 2.6k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Aldose Reductase and Taurine (7 papers), Neuropeptides and Animal Physiology (4 papers) and Muscle metabolism and nutrition (3 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Cell Biology (507 citations), Molecular Biology (1.7k citations) and Immunology (365 citations). James A. Cromlish has collaborated with scholars based in Canada, United States and United Kingdom. Frequent co-authors include Robert G. Roeder, Nabil G. Seidah, Michel Chrétien, T.G. Flynn, Suzanne Benjannet, Ajoy Basak, P. Anthony Weil, Thomas Gerster, Claus Scheidereit and Kiyoshi Kawakami. Their work appears in journals such as Nature, Proceedings of the National Academy of Sciences and Journal of Biological Chemistry.
